Sample travel plan for Himachal Tour Packages From Ramagundam


Day 1: Arrival in Shimla

- Arrive in Shimla, the capital of Himachal Pradesh.
- Check into your hotel.
- Evening free for leisure to explore the Mall Road and enjoy the pleasant weather.

Day 2: Shimla Local Sightseeing

- Visit top attractions in Shimla, including the Ridge, Christ Church, Jakhoo Temple, and Mall Road.
- Enjoy scenic views of the surrounding hills.

Day 3: Shimla to Manali

- Depart for Manali, a picturesque hill station.
- En-route, visit Kullu Valley.
- Check into your Manali hotel and relax.

Day 4: Manali Excursion

- Explore the Solang Valley, known for adventure activities like paragliding and zorbing.
- Visit the Rohtang Pass (subject to weather conditions).
- Return to Manali for the night.

Day 5: Manali Local Sightseeing

- Discover the attractions of Manali, including Hadimba Devi Temple, Manu Temple, and the Old Manali area.
- Explore the local markets.

Day 6: Departure to Ramagundam

- Drive to Chandigarh, the capital of Punjab and Haryana.
- Visit the Rock Garden and Rose Garden.
- Transfer to the Chandigarh Airport or Railway Station for your journey back home.

Top places to visit in Himachal Pradesh:

Himachal Pradesh, located in the northern part of India, is a paradise for travelers, offering a wide range of picturesque destinations. Here are some of the top places to visit in Himachal Pradesh:

Shimla: The state capital and a famous hill station, Shimla boasts colonial architecture, the Mall Road, and scenic views from the Ridge.
  
Manali: Nestled in the Kullu Valley, Manali is known for its stunning landscapes, adventure activities, and vibrant markets.
  
Dharamshala and McLeod Ganj: The residence of the Dalai Lama, this region is a blend of Tibetan and Indian cultures. Explore monasteries, scenic treks, and the Tsuglagkhang Complex.
  
Dalhousie: A colonial-era hill station with old-world charm, including the St. John's Church and Panchpula waterfall.
  
Kullu: Famous for adventure sports, Kullu offers river rafting, trekking, and the picturesque Manikaran Sahib Gurudwara.
  
Spiti Valley: An unspoiled high-altitude desert offering dramatic landscapes, ancient monasteries, and unique experiences.
  
Chamba: Known for its ancient temples and art, Chamba is a historical town with impressive architecture.
  
Kasol and Parvati Valley: A haven for backpackers, Kasol offers a relaxed atmosphere, trekking, and hot springs.
  
Manikaran: Home to hot springs and a significant pilgrimage site for Sikhs and Hindus.
  
Chitkul: A charming and remote village in Kinnaur Valley, known for its scenic beauty and serene atmosphere.
  
Kufri: A small hill station near Shimla, famous for its beautiful views, including the Himalayan Nature Park.
  
Bir and Billing: Renowned for paragliding, these twin villages offer adventure activities and serene landscapes.
  
Khajjiar: Often referred to as the "Mini Switzerland of India," this place is famous for its lush green meadows and a beautiful lake.
  
Narkanda: A lesser-known gem, Narkanda offers apple orchards, stunning views, and a quiet atmosphere.
  
Solan: Known as the "Mushroom Capital of India," Solan is surrounded by lush forests and offers a tranquil experience.
  
Palampur: A serene town known for its tea gardens, scenic landscapes, and pleasant weather.
  
Barot: A hidden gem for nature lovers, Barot is known for its lush forests, trout fishing, and trekking trails.
  
Kasauli: A quiet hill station with colonial-era architecture and great views from Monkey Point.
  
Malana: Known for its distinct culture, Malana is a unique village in the Parvati Valley.
  
Bilaspur: Home to the scenic Gobind Sagar Lake, Bilaspur offers water sports and stunning views.

Himachal Pradesh offers something for every type of traveler, from adventure enthusiasts to nature lovers, history buffs, and those seeking peaceful retreats in the lap of the Himalayas.

7. When is the best time to visit Himachal Pradesh?
  
 - The best time to visit Himachal Pradesh depends on your preferences. Summer (April to June) is ideal for pleasant weather, while winter (December to February) is perfect for snow enthusiasts. The monsoon season (July to September) should be avoided due to heavy rainfall.
